What volume of oil is extracted in Georgia?
A-
+A

Oil production in Georgia has been at its highest level since 2015. According to the data of the Georgian Oil and Gas Corporation (GOGC), last year, 39.1 thousand tons of crude oil were extracted in Georgia. In 2021, this figure was 35.3 thousand tons.
22.06 thousand tons out of the extracted oil belonged to the investors, while 17.04 thousand tons - to the government. The government usually sells its share of oil at an auction. Oil extracted in Georgia is of Georgian Light and Georgian Heavy types.
In 2009-22, 2009 was distinguished by oil extraction, when the oil volume was 57.6 thousand tons.
